The Anatomy of a High-Converting Landing Page in 2025

A landing page is more than just a pretty design—it’s a tool to turn visitors into leads or customers. In 2025, with user attention spans shorter than ever, your landing page must work hard and fast. Let’s break down what makes a landing page truly effective in today's competitive digital environment.


1. Clear and Compelling Headline

Your headline is the first thing people see. In 2025, clarity beats creativity. A high-converting landing page uses a headline that instantly communicates the value or solution being offered.

✅ Example: “Boost Your Email Signups by 300% with Our Free Guide.”


2. Engaging Visuals

Minimalist designs with vibrant accents are in trend this year. Use high-quality images, SVG icons, or hero videos that support your message. Animations should be subtle and purposeful.

👉 Tip: Make sure all visuals load quickly, especially on mobile.


3. Laser-Focused Value Proposition

Answer the question, “Why should I care?” in the first few seconds. A value proposition highlights what makes your offer unique and how it benefits the user.

📌 Format:

  • Problem

  • Solution

  • Why You?


4. Persuasive Call-to-Action (CTA)

Your CTA should stand out visually and contain action-oriented text. Use color contrast, short phrases, and urgency to drive clicks.

🎯 Examples:

  • “Get Started Now”

  • “Claim Your Free Trial”

  • “Download the Report”


5. Trust Builders and Social Proof

In 2025, users demand instant credibility. Include:

  • Customer testimonials

  • Trust badges (security, payment options)

  • Client logos or user stats (e.g. “Trusted by 10,000+ users”)


6. Simple, Distraction-Free Layout

Avoid overwhelming users with too many options. Keep your layout clean with one core message and goal.

✅ Use:

  • Clear sections

  • Bullet points

  • Plenty of white space


7. Mobile Optimization

Over 70% of users view landing pages on mobile. Your landing page must be:

  • Fully responsive

  • Fast loading

  • Easy to read and interact with (buttons, forms, CTAs)


8. Short and Smart Forms

Only ask for necessary information. Shorter forms = more conversions.

💡 Tip: Use autofill, inline validation, and show how secure the form is.


9. Exit Intent & Retargeting Strategy

Use smart popups or retargeting tools if a visitor tries to leave. Offer a discount, bonus content, or reminder.


10. Analytics & A/B Testing

Use tools like Google Optimize or Hotjar to test:

  • Headline variations

  • CTA placement

  • Color schemes

Data-driven decisions will keep improving performance.


Conclusion

A successful landing page in 2025 combines sleek, mobile-friendly design with clear messaging, social proof, and a strong CTA. Whether you're gathering leads or selling a product, every element should guide the visitor toward one goal: conversion.
